Market Share Analysis of Top Steel Suppliers in Major Regions Worldwide
The global steel market shows significant variance among key players based on regional distribution. Recent reports indicate that Asia-Pacific leads in steel production, accounting for over 50% of the world’s total output. China dominates this region, producing more than 900 million metric tons each year. However, this concentration raises concerns. A heavy reliance on one country's production creates market vulnerabilities.
In North America, steel consumption is projected to grow by 3.2% annually, while Europe’s market is expected to expand by only 1.5%. This divergence suggests potential trade opportunities for suppliers outside Asia-Pacific. Economically, Europe’s decarbonization targets may challenge growth. Yet, emerging markets in Africa show promise, with an expected rise in demand.
Supply chain disruptions due to geopolitical tensions further complicate matters. A recent survey highlighted that 40% of steel buyers faced unexpected delays in procurement. As global demand fluctuates, suppliers should be adaptable. Bottlenecks in logistics can result in missed opportunities. Therefore, a more diversified approach to sourcing and supply is essential for sustainability and competitiveness in the global steel market.
Sustainability Practices Among Leading Steel Product Suppliers: A Comparative Review
Sustainability has become a critical benchmark in the steel industry. Many steel product suppliers now emphasize eco-friendly practices. According to a recent report by the World Steel Association, the industry accounts for about 7% of global carbon emissions. This fact raises concerns and calls for immediate action.
Leading suppliers are increasingly adopting circular economy principles. They focus on recycling materials and enhancing energy efficiency. For instance, some manufacturers report using up to 90% recycled steel in their production. Despite these efforts, challenges remain. Many suppliers still face limitations regarding the adoption of green technologies. The high cost of implementing sustainable processes often hinders progress.
Consumer demand for sustainable practices is rising. A survey indicated that over 70% of buyers prefer suppliers with strong sustainability initiatives. However, transparency remains an issue. Some companies fail to disclose their environmental impact, creating skepticism among consumers. Suppliers must improve reporting and accountability to truly lead in sustainability.
Emerging Technologies Shaping the Future of Steel Supply Chains and Products
Emerging technologies are radically transforming steel supply chains and product offerings. Innovations like automation, AI, and IoT are streamlining operations and improving efficiency. A report from McKinsey indicates that digital technologies could enhance productivity in the steel industry by up to 30%. This shift is crucial as steel consumption is projected to grow by 2% annually through 2025.
Sustainable practices are also taking center stage. Technologies like electric arc furnaces (EAF) are gaining traction. EAFs can reduce CO2 emissions by up to 75% compared to traditional blast furnaces. The World Steel Association suggests that the steel industry must adopt greener strategies to meet global climate targets. The focus on sustainability is reshaping supplier relationships and product development.
